Ok, so I’m a lifelong Buckeye who came to the big city in 1996 after 8 years at a great Commercial Furniture Dealership in Columbus, Ohio as Marketing and New Business Development Manager.

I came to Long Island to work for another great dealership, BFI Office Furniture in Melville, NY. After about a year I was recruited the folks at Wieland Furniture and that started a very long career with that great company as Territory Manager in New York and New Jersey. After a few years, Wieland was purchased by Sauder Manufacturing and they split into vertical markets and I chose my true passion, Healthcare.

During this time, I started a firm, Margen Designs, that provided Fabrics and Architectural Materials to the Healthcare and Educational firms in the tri-state area. We were fortunate to be the only firm to acquire a NYC Health+Hospitals Contract for Upholstery and Carpet Cleaning! We provided upholstery cleaning, maintenance and training to the 36+ Hospitals in the network, along with many other hospitals and colleges in the area!

I love all Furniture, Fabrics and Architectural Materials and anyone that has any dealings with me knows I’m extremely passionate about all of those things (probably overly so….) but it works for me!

In 2019 I reevaluated what I really wanted to do, like many of us, and chose to leave my positions and open my own Interiors Consulting Firm, Poppy Lane Interiors.

I wanted to share my knowledge and experience with clients and other design professionals I had met over the years. I began consulting with A&D Firms and large Healthcare clients providing RFP Services, Sourcing of furniture, fabrics and architectural materials.

I also chose to represent three manufacturers that I feel meld perfectly together in the commercial arena: Commercial Flooring, H Contract/Hooker Resimercial Furniture and Artline Group. These 3 manufacturers gave me the ability to bring a very unique package to my clients, which include A&D Firms, Contractors, Furniture and Flooring Dealers and Installers.
